A Graduate Certificate in Mobile Technology and Community Empowerment equips students with the skills to leverage mobile technologies for social good. The program focuses on practical application, bridging the gap between technological innovation and community development.
Learning outcomes include proficiency in mobile application development for specific community needs, data analysis for impact assessment, and project management skills for sustainable initiatives. Students will develop a strong understanding of ethical considerations and community engagement strategies within a mobile technology context.
The program's duration is typically designed for completion within one year of part-time study, allowing working professionals to upskill and enhance their careers. This flexible structure makes it accessible to a broader range of individuals passionate about using mobile technology for positive social impact.
This Graduate Certificate holds significant industry relevance. Graduates are prepared for roles in NGOs, social enterprises, and government agencies working on digital inclusion and community development projects.
